首页 特殊行业应用 正文内容

java安全的即时聊天系统(java在线聊天系统)

EchoBird 特殊行业应用 2025-06-13 16:00:16 2 0

本文目录一览:

有谁介绍一个即时通信软件,最好是开源的,能够自己部署服务

FastMsg 是一款免费企业即时通讯软件,界面简洁,良好的用户体验,无任何功能限制,可下载服务端程序自由部署到局域网或公网服务器。它集成了组织架构、即时通讯、网页客服、文件传输、语音视频、远程协助、公告通知等功能,开放式的应用中心,用户可自行集成自己的应用,是企业零成本搭建即时通讯平台的最佳选择。

EMQ简介 EMQ,一个开源MQTT服务器,支持百万级并发连接,全协议,易于部署在多种操作系统上,支持扩展插件。EMQ适应物联网需求,提供可靠的数据传输。EMQ安装 选择Windows平台搭建EMQ服务器,下载安装EMQ。搭建环境 下载并解压EMQ,配置路径,使用命令行启动服务。

支持文字、语音、视频聊天以及文件分享等操作。 WhatsApp:WhatsApp在台湾地区也颇受欢迎,用户可以通过它进行文字沟通、语音通话、视频聊天以及文件传输等。 Telegram:作为一款开源通讯应用,Telegram在台湾也拥有一定的用户基础,提供文本、语音、视频聊天以及文件传输等服务。

要快速入门开源即时通讯IM框架MobileIMSDK的H5端开发,您可以按照以下步骤进行:技术准备 了解WebSocket技术:确保对WebSocket这一底层通信机制有清晰的认识,可以参考WebSocket标准文档和API手册。

java开发视频聊天接入哪个SDK比较好?

基于Java开发音视频通话场景,推荐使用ZEGO即构科技的音视频SDK。以下是选择ZEGO音视频SDK的几点原因:强大的兼容性:ZEGO音视频SDK支持包括Java在内的多种编程语言,同时兼容iOS、Android、Windows、macOS、Web、h5和小程序等25种平台和语言,确保开发者在不同环境下的应用需求都能得到满足。

在进行Java开发视频聊天应用时,选择合适的SDK极为关键。经过综合评估,推荐接入ZEGO即构的音视频SDK。该SDK具备强大功能,支持高达32路实时音视频通话,且提供1080P高清画质,确保用户享受流畅、清晰的视频通话体验。ZEGO即构SDK不仅在画面质量上表现出色,更在延迟控制上有着显著优势。

为了在Java Web上实现实时视频通话,推荐直接使用现成的SDK来实现,这样能提高效率。以zego即构科技的实时视频SDK为例,只需要四行代码即可接入,30分钟内即可快速实现音视频功能。在开发实时视频通话应用时,直接使用现成的SDK可以节省大量时间,并且能够确保功能的高效实现。

可以试试ZEGO即构科技的SDK,他们的产品适合在java语言框架上实现视频通话,即构是互联网公司巨头,当初我们也是选择的他们,不过不是使用视频SDK,是在小程序上构建实时语音场景,还不错。

要想java web 实现实时视频通话,建议直接用现成sdk来实现,这样效率更高,比如zego即构科技的实时视频sdk,支持四行代码即可接入,30分钟内可快速实现音视频功能。

用手机java的QQ可以和电脑上的QQ进行语音通话吗?

1、手机上的QQ可以与电脑上的QQ进行语音通话。首先,QQ是一款跨平台的即时通讯软件,支持多种设备之间的互通,包括手机、电脑和其他终端。使用手机Java版QQ和电脑QQ进行语音通话是完全可行的,只要两者都在联网状态下,并且已登录同一个QQ账号或好友账号。其次,在进行语音通话前,确保你的设备和网络环境良好。

2、发图片只需要手机QQ版本到了就可以。手机QQ2011 第3版以后就支持发送手机上的图片。 而视频通话目前只能够用QQ FOR PAD 第3版可以视频通话,但是只能是手机和手机。 电脑和手机QQ不行。

3、可以的 移动QQ是按GPS流量来计算的 具体的如下: 说明: 使用手机和电脑访问 3g.qq.com 产生的页面完全不相同。 3g手机门户的QQ服务基于网页技术,没有声音提示,读取好友最新信息提示需要刷新页面。

4、要让MSN和手机QQ进行聊天,首先需要确保手机型号支持JAVA功能。支持JAVA功能的手机能够下载特定应用或插件,这使得用户能够在手机上运行复杂的程序,如MSN或QQ等即时通讯软件。用户可以通过电脑下载所需的应用,或者直接在手机的浏览器上访问下载链接,完成安装。

用PHP/java开发个类似QQ的即时通讯软件一般要多长时间。

1、综上所述,开发一个类似QQ的即时通讯软件,如果功能相对简单,可能只需要2到4周的时间,但如果功能复杂,可能需要3到6个月甚至更长的时间。当然,这只是一个大致的估算,实际开发过程中可能会出现各种预料之外的情况,导致项目延期。

2、在寻找参考资料时,我找到了一些相关的讨论帖。例如,你可以参考这个链接:http://bbs.99nets.com/read.php?tid=655383&fpage=9。在帖子中,用户们分享了许多宝贵的经验和建议,虽然内容较多,但还是值得花时间仔细阅读。如果你想学习开发即时通讯软件,第一步可以参考别人的成功案例。

3、短信:可利用会议短信通知功能,让用户第一时间得知会议信息。 三 使用即时通讯时传送文件的方法有几种 IM软件能点对点的传输文件,有时候利用此功能要比使用E-mail还方便许多,当然此项功能必须在对方在线时才能使用。

4、一般是用某种程序设计语言来实现的软件开发的,像Java、Python、2C和C++等都是软件开发的需要的编程语言。看到那么多编程语言,同学又就开始犯嘀咕,这么多,到底学什么?今天听人说Java不错,想学;明天听人说Python前景广,想学;为什么会迷茫,还不是因为你不够了解他们。

5、而VC/VB/Dephi则主要用于常规应用程序的开发,比如大家熟悉的QQ等即时通讯软件,都是用这些语言编写的。因此,这些语言在软件开发领域也有着广泛的应用。至于Java、ASP.net和PHP,则是近几年网络开发领域最为流行的编程语言。

给我提供一个Java编写的聊天工具原代码

1、我这里有一个简单的聊天室程序:包括服务器和客户端用VB的winsock实现的,需要跟我联系就是,免费赠送。QQ361656515网络编程——聊天室(代码如下)本程序是基于VB开发环境中Winsock控件的应用,遵循TCP/IP协议,利用该控件的套接字功能,实现远程计算机之间数据通信的,它由服务器和客户端组成。

2、在Eclipse等IDE中运行Java源代码:如果使用Eclipse等集成开发环境(IDE),则可以通过IDE提供的图形界面来编写、编译和运行Java源代码。通常,只需在IDE中创建一个新的Java项目,然后将源代码文件添加到项目中。IDE会自动处理编译和运行过程,用户只需点击相应的按钮或菜单项即可。

3、下面是一段使用Java编写的简单程序,它可以接收用户输入的两个字符,并比较它们的ASCII码值,输出较大的字符及其ASCII码。程序首先导入了Scanner类以实现用户输入,然后创建了一个名为Sort的类,其中包含了主方法main。

4、Java编程软件Eclipse推荐 Eclipse是一个极为受欢迎的Java编程软件,以下是对Eclipse的详细介绍及推荐理由:Eclipse的基本介绍 开放源代码:Eclipse是一个开放源代码的项目,这意味着其源代码是公开的,开发者可以自由地查看、修改和使用。

5、要查看导入的一个Java项目的后台各功能源代码位置,可以按照以下步骤进行: 确认项目的MVC结构: 大多数Java Web项目采用MVC架构。在这种架构中,Controller层负责处理HTTP请求。 找到Controller包: 在IDE中,项目的源代码通常按包组织。Controller层的代码一般位于名为controller或类似名称的包中。

6、特点:提供智能编码辅助、自动控制、重构等高级功能;支持Ant、GIT、JUnit、J2EE、SVN等集成;拥有美观的界面和高效的操作体验。付费情况:虽然IntelliJ IDEA是付费软件,但针对Java等语言是免费的,用户无需额外支付费用即可使用。Eclipse 简介:Eclipse是一个开放源代码的、基于Java的可扩展开发平台。

欢迎 发表评论:

文章目录
    搜索